WebFeb 5, 2024 · Progressive supranuclear palsy (PSP) is a condition that causes both dementia and problems with movement. It is a progressive condition that mainly affects people aged over 60. The word ‘supranuclear’ refers to the parts of the brain just above the nerve cells that control eye movement. WebA wide-eyed staring expression. Other symptoms of PSP include: Difficulty swallowing. Stiff muscles that affect mobility (your ability to move). Difficulty speaking. Your speech might be quieter and slurred, making it hard to pronounce words. Mood changes, such as depression, apathy (loss of interest) and irritability.
